Understanding the User:
Understanding the user is essential for design, as it allows us to know who they are, what their needs are, and how they interact with the product. Conducting prior research on the type of user our design is aimed at helps us focus on important aspects, such as age, location, gender, among others.
Product Understanding:
Before you start designing, it’s crucial to have a clear understanding of your product’s goals. For example, if you’re designing a mobile app for task management, your goals might be to improve user productivity and organization. Design Consistency: Maintaining consistency across all elements of the interface, from typography to colors to the layout of elements, ensures a smooth and familiar user experience.
Accessibility: A good UX/UI design should be accessible to all users, regardless of their abilities. Considering aspects such as contrast, readability, and easy navigation is crucial.
Feedback and Continuous Improvement: Integrating user feedback into the design process is essential to identify areas for improvement and constantly evolve the experience offered.

To finish this article I will show you 2 examples of real cases in which I was involved, and applied my knowledge about the principles of good design.
Billsy is a marketplace application where users can view and purchase items quickly and safely.With a focus on the target audience between 18 and 35 years old, who frequently use applications for online shopping, the design of the application has focused on simplicity.It has ensured that the navigation and information on the cards, details and buttons are easily accessible, both for reading and for adaptation on various devices (mobile phones and tablets).

I'm calling you is an application for renting and selling real estate, where users can view and publish apartments and houses in a simple and fast way.Users can access detailed information about the properties at any time and have the contacts of the owners or real estate agencies to communicate directly with them.
In this app, our main goal was to highlight 'The Information' above all else.We wanted to make the app simple and straight forward so that users can easily navigate between the various posts and understand what each one is about.In addition, we make sure that all the information you need is always in sight.
